Tabitha M Cabatino, LCSW

Social Work
Social Work
Tabitha Cabatino LCSW, is a Behavioral Health Clinician within the Center for Adult Anxiety & OCD at AHN's Psychiatry and Behavioral Health Institute. Tabitha provides hybrid outpatient individual psychotherapy for adults with a variety of anxiety concerns (stress, adjustment related, social anxiety, panic and other) grief and loss, and depression. Tabitha received her Bachelor of Arts in Japanese and International Relations from the University of Pittsburgh and received her Master of Social Work at the University of Pittsburgh, with a certificate in mental health and integrated healthcare. She has worked in the social work role for AHN’s psychiatry and pain institutes prior to clinical licensure with experiences in different settings. Tabitha focuses on the person-in-environment perspective of an individual’s behavioral and cognitive challenges.
